The hostel facilities at the college are varied, with 11 hostels in total, including 2 for girls and 9 for boys. The accommodation primarily involves room sharing, with 4 to 6 students per room in the initial years and single rooms available in the final year, specifically in Jhelum Hostel. The average hostel rent is approximately Rs 4000 to Rs 8000 per semester, with a separate mess fee around Rs 15,000 to Rs 21,000 per semester.
The infrastructure includes high-speed internet, regular electricity, and hot water facilities. Sanitation is maintained daily, but the quality of mess food is frequently criticized as below average. Recreational facilities, including common areas for games and TV, are available. Some hostels are newly constructed or under renovation, while others, particularly those affected by past floods, require updates. The college also provides a registration process for hostels during admission, making it accessible and affordable for students, especially those from outside the 20 km radius of the campus.
